Besides teaching a child before he or she is born, the physical environment of the womb as well as the whole of the mother’s body is critical to a child’s growth and development.
In order for a healthy pregnancy, mothers must eat a balance diet which consists of fresh vegetables and fruit. Eating fish is good too as fish contains essential fatty acids that are known to boost brain growth. Another way of ensuring good nutrition during pregnancy is to eat or drink at least three servings of dairy products and food rich in calcium a day. Extra calcium is required for bone growth and teeth formation in the child.
